Yes, Nick Stafford's adaptation of "War Horse" for the stage reflects influences from various theatrical styles, including elements of puppetry and physical theater. The use of life-sized horse puppets, designed by Handspring Puppet Company, draws on traditional and contemporary puppet techniques, creating a unique visual and emotional experience. Additionally, Stafford's narrative style incorporates dramatic storytelling and evocative imagery, enhancing the overall impact of the piece. This blend of influences helps convey the story's themes of friendship, courage, and the horrors of war.
